Home >> Business Insurance >> Post

Previous Post: Key Differences Between Business Insurance and Personal Insurance Policies

08/14/2023

The ROI of Business Insurance | How It Safeguards Your Financial Future


Understanding the Financial Impact of Business Risks

In the world of entrepreneurship, managing risks is a fundamental aspect of ensuring the longevity and success of a business. From unexpected accidents to legal disputes, a myriad of threats can pose significant financial challenges to companies of all sizes. This is where business insurance steps in, not just as a protective shield but as an investment that offers a tangible return on investment (ROI) by safeguarding your business's financial future.

The Risk Landscape of Business Operations

Before delving into the ROI of business insurance, it's essential to grasp the diverse range of risks businesses face daily. These risks can broadly be categorized into:

1. Physical Risks: These encompass natural disasters like floods, earthquakes, and fires that can damage your property and disrupt your operations. Additionally, theft and vandalism fall under this category.

2. Liability Risks: Legal claims due to injuries, property damage, or negligence can result in hefty lawsuits. These not only drain your financial resources but can also tarnish your business's reputation.

3. Operational Risks: These include supply chain disruptions, equipment breakdowns, and business interruptions. Such events can lead to decreased revenue and increased expenses.

4. Cyber Risks: In the digital age, data breaches, hacking, and cyberattacks can compromise sensitive information, resulting in financial losses and legal liabilities.

5. Employee-Related Risks: Accidents in the workplace can lead to workers' compensation claims. Moreover, disputes related to wrongful termination or discrimination can result in legal actions.

The Business Impact of Uninsured Risks

The financial consequences of these risks can be severe. Imagine a scenario where a fire engulfs your business premises. Without property insurance, you would be burdened with the cost of repairing or rebuilding the property, replacing equipment, and potentially covering the loss of income during the downtime.

Likewise, legal actions due to injuries sustained by customers on your premises or through the use of your products can lead to colossal settlements. Without liability insurance, your business assets could be seized to cover these settlements, and legal proceedings might force you to divert valuable time and money away from core business activities.

Furthermore, consider the damage caused by a cyberattack that compromises your customers' sensitive data. Not only would you need to invest in rectifying the breach, but you might also face legal penalties and loss of customer trust. Cyber liability insurance can help mitigate these costs and provide expert assistance in managing the aftermath of such incidents.

The Role of Business Insurance as an Investment

Business insurance fundamentally works as a financial safety net that prevents unforeseen events from causing irreparable damage to your business's financial health. It offers peace of mind, knowing that the monetary burden of unexpected events won't jeopardize your company's operations or existence.

The Tangible Financial Benefits of Comprehensive Business Insurance

1. Minimizing Financial Losses

The primary purpose of business insurance is to act as a financial cushion when the unexpected occurs. Insurance policies cover a wide range of risks, including property damage, liability claims, and business interruptions. By having comprehensive coverage, you are better equipped to recover swiftly and with minimal financial setbacks.

For instance, consider a retail business hit by a natural disaster that results in extensive property damage and forces a temporary closure. With the right insurance coverage, the costs of repairs, lost income during the closure, and even expenses related to relocating temporarily can be covered. This significantly reduces the financial strain that such an event could impose.

2. Enhancing Business Continuity

Business interruptions can be financially devastating, especially for small and medium-sized enterprises. Insurance policies like business interruption insurance play a vital role in maintaining business continuity during challenging times. This coverage provides compensation for lost income and ongoing expenses when your operations are disrupted due to covered events.

By enabling you to maintain essential cash flow even when your doors are temporarily closed, business interruption insurance ensures that your financial stability remains intact. This allows you to resume operations as quickly as possible, minimizing the long-term impact on your revenue and customer relationships.

3. Unlocking Growth Opportunities

Strategic investments often lead to growth, and comprehensive business insurance is no exception. When you have a safety net in place to address potential risks, you can focus more confidently on pursuing growth opportunities that might otherwise seem risky.

For instance, you might consider expanding to a new location or launching a new product line. With liability insurance in place, the fear of potential legal claims due to accidents or injuries is mitigated. This empowers you to make bold decisions that can elevate your business's financial standing and market reach.

4. Strengthening Market Reputation

The financial benefits of business insurance extend beyond just recovering from losses. Reputation is invaluable in the business world, and being well-insured can enhance your credibility and trustworthiness in the eyes of customers, partners, and investors.

Having insurance coverage signals that your business is well-prepared to handle challenges and take responsibility for any potential mishaps. This commitment to risk management can set you apart from competitors and attract stakeholders who value businesses with a solid risk mitigation strategy.

5. Attracting Favorable Financing Terms. When seeking financing, whether it's a loan from a bank or an investment from a venture capitalist, having comprehensive business insurance can work in your favor. Lenders and investors often assess the risk profile of a business before extending funds. By showcasing your commitment to managing risks through insurance, you demonstrate that you are a responsible and trustworthy borrower or investment opportunity.

Comprehensive business insurance is far from being just an expense; it's a strategic investment that yields a tangible return by safeguarding your financial future. It minimizes losses, ensures business continuity, unlocks growth opportunities, enhances your reputation, and even contributes to favorable financing terms. Stay tuned to learn how to maximize the ROI of your insurance investment.

Maximizing the ROI of Your Business Insurance Investment

1. Assessing Your Risk Profile

Before diving into insurance policies, it's crucial to evaluate your business's specific risk profile. Different industries and business models face varying degrees of risks. A thorough risk assessment helps you identify the areas where insurance coverage is most critical.

Consider the nature of your operations, the assets you own, the potential liabilities you might incur, and any external factors that could impact your business. This assessment will guide you in determining which types of insurance policies are the most relevant for your business.

2. Customizing Coverage

Business insurance is not a one-size-fits-all solution. Tailoring your coverage to your business's unique needs is key to maximizing its ROI. Work closely with insurance professionals who understand your industry and can provide expert advice on the types and levels of coverage that align with your risk profile.

For example, if you're in the healthcare sector, your liability risks might be different from those of a manufacturing company. Customizing your coverage ensures that you're adequately protected where you need it most and aren't paying for unnecessary coverage.

3. Reviewing Policies Regularly

As your business evolves, so do its risks and insurance needs. Regular policy reviews are essential to ensure that your coverage remains up-to-date and aligned with your current operations. Changes such as expansion to new locations, introducing new products or services, or shifting to remote work can impact your risk profile.

An annual review with your insurance provider allows you to make any necessary adjustments to your coverage. This not only keeps your protection current but also prevents overpaying for coverage you no longer require.

4. Comparing Quotes and Providers

When it comes to maximizing ROI, cost-efficiency matters. Don't settle for the first insurance quote you receive. Reach out to multiple insurance providers and request quotes that are tailored to your specific coverage needs. Comparing quotes gives you a comprehensive view of the market and ensures you're getting the best value for your investment.

Remember that while cost is important, it's not the only factor to consider. Evaluate the reputation and customer service of insurance providers to ensure a smooth claims process and reliable support when you need it most.

5. Educating Your Team

Maximizing the ROI of your business insurance investment isn't solely the responsibility of management. Educating your employees about the importance of risk management and insurance can contribute to a culture of safety and accountability.

Empower your team to recognize potential risks and follow safety protocols. This proactive approach can prevent accidents and incidents that might lead to insurance claims, ultimately reducing your long-term insurance costs.

Conclusion

Business insurance is a strategic investment that safeguards your financial future by mitigating risks and providing valuable protection. By assessing your risk profile, customizing coverage, reviewing policies regularly, comparing quotes, and educating your team, you can ensure that your insurance investment delivers a substantial return on investment.

As you navigate the complex landscape of business risks, remember that an informed and proactive approach to insurance selection and management not only safeguards your business but also contributes to its long-term financial success. With these insights, you're well-equipped to make informed decisions that will positively impact your business's bottom line.

Another resource you may want to check: Insurance Information Institute (III)


Next Post: Navigating Business Insurance Quotes | Tips for Finding the Best Coverage

Home >> Business Insurance >> Post